Mycalesis dubia

Wikipedia Abstract

Bicyclus dubia, the Dubious Scalloped Bush Brown, is a butterfly in the Nymphalidae family. It is found in Cameroon, the Central African Republic, the southern part of the Democratic Republic of Congo, western Uganda, north-western Tanzania and north-western Zambia. The habitat consists of swamp and riverine forests. Adults are attracted to fermented bananas. The larvae feed on Poaceae species.
